测试自动化程序

时间:2012-10-08 17:12:03

标签: testing automated-tests cucumber

那里有一个程序,我不能为我的生活记住这个名字。我不确定这是否是正确的论坛,但我想我会试一试,看看是否有人可以帮助我。

计划说明:

该程序用于编写和运行测试自动化。它允许您用英语编写测试步骤。

示例(场景:发布堆栈溢出问题):

  1. 输入标题'XXX'
  2. 输入说明
  3. 输入标签'X'
  4. 点击发布按钮
  5. 在输入英语句子的测试步骤后,您可以运行测试。测试将返回黄色,表示并非所有步骤都是自动化的,并为上述4个步骤中的每个步骤创建存根方法。

    然后,您可以完成自动化不同步骤和运行测试的工作。

    很抱歉,如果这听起来含糊不清,但我记得去年看过这个软件,似乎无法找到它或记住这个名字。

    有什么想法吗?

2 个答案:

答案 0 :(得分:1)

Ruby Gem Cucumber

答案 1 :(得分:0)

那就是Cucumber

如果您有未定义的方案或步骤,它将警告您,并且会为这些步骤提供一些代码段,如本"10 min tutorial"所示。